The Zuckerman Museum of Art is pleased to offer a weekly free opportunity to practice your observational drawing skills. Join us on Thursday nights from 6:00 to 8:00 PM for our Drawing in the Gallery program series. Each week we will rotate the drawing location in our galleries and the subject of the program between a clothed model, nude model, and objects from our collection. This program is a bring-your-own material event – pencil and paper only. The museum will provide drawing boards to participants upon request.
